Sinopsis

What happens when the quietest child in the classroom is paired with the loudest one?

On the very first day of school, shy Pip hopes to disappear into the background. But everything changes when cheerful, energetic Myrna bounces into the seat beside him with endless smiles, sparkling surprises, and an invitation to be friends.

As the days unfold, Pip discovers that friendship doesn't always begin with big words-it can start with a small act of kindness, a shared laugh, and someone who believes in you before you believe in yourself. Together, the unlikely pair learns that introverts and extroverts don't have to be alike to become the very best of friends. Their differences become their greatest strength, proving that every personality has something wonderful to offer.

Filled with heartwarming moments, gentle humor, lovable animal characters, and meaningful lessons about empathy, courage, and acceptance, Best Friend of the Class Introvert is a touching picture book that celebrates authentic friendship and reminds young readers that they never have to change who they are to belong.

Perfect for children ages 3-8, this delightful story encourages confidence, kindness, and the beautiful truth that sometimes the best friend you'll ever make is the one who is completely different from you.
